Product Details

Our greeting cards are 5" x 7" in size and are produced on digital offset printers using 100 lb. paper stock. Each card is coated with a UV protectant on the outside surface which produces a semi-gloss finish. The inside of each card has a matte white finish and can be customized with your own message up to 500 characters in length. Each card comes with a white envelope for mailing or gift giving.

About John T Humphrey

John T Humphrey

Born in Florida, raised in Tennessee, Georgia, Alabama, Midway Island, and Southern California, retired from Verizon Communications, and now with my wife Malinda, have found our home in Carson Valley, Nevada. My passion has always been wildlife and the outdoors, from viewing, to conservation, but mostly photography. For the past forty years I have played with photography, shooting family, military air shows, wildlife, and events, but for the past eight years I have become very aware of the wildlife in Carson Valley. My main focus when shooting is safety and preservation of my subjects, including wild horses, bears, wildcats, and raptors.
